Located within the Hotel Wilden Mann, Burgerstube is a rustic, Michelin-star restaurant decorated in early 20th century neo-gothic style that serves a menu of regional treats and Pan-Asian fare. The restaurant has a cozy, candlelit dining room which creates a warm and welcoming ambiance in which diners can enjoy traditional Swiss cuisine such as bratwurst, cordon bleu, and the Lucerne specialty chögelipastetli. Other signature dishes on the menu include sliced veal with rösti, poached scallops in elderberry sauce, and crab terrine with saffron mayonnaise, and decadent desserts like creme brûlée with berries and apricot and amaretto terrine are to die for. The acclaimed cuisine is accompanied by world-class fine wines from around the world, imported spirits and classic cocktails, and the restaurant is open for lunch and dinner daily.
